Numbered list indent increases after 10th entry with 16pt font
Last modified: 2010-07-01 15:35:45 UTC
If you create a numbered list with a font size of 16 pts to about 22 pts there is a dramatic increase in the indent when the list goes from the 9th entry to the 10th. If the font size is smaller, like 12 pts or 14 pts this issue does not occur. If the font size is larger than 22 pts then the indent is large even for 1 to 9. I could find no way to work around this flaw.
